Introduction / Context:
The softening point of bitumen indicates the temperature at which the binder transitions to a softer, less viscous state. It is crucial for grading asphalt binders and anticipating performance in hot climates.

Concept / Approach:
The Ring-and-Ball (Ball and Ring) method heats a bitumen sample in a brass ring and records the temperature at which a steel ball drops a specified distance through the softened bitumen. This directly defines the softening point.

Verification / Alternative check:
Standards (e.g., ASTM D36) define the Ring-and-Ball softening point method for asphalt binders.
